Concrete Raising in West Des Moines, IA

Concrete raising services involve l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ces to restore their original position and appearance. This process is commonly used for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have developed cracks, settled, or become uneven over time. Property owners typically seek this service to improve safety, prevent further damage, and enhance curb appeal without the need for complete replacement of the concrete.

Before requesting concrete raising,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including which areas can be effectively repaired and how the process will be performed. It's helpful to consider the extent of the settlement or cracks, the age of the concrete, and any underlying issues that may need addressing. Proper assessment ensures that the concrete can be successfully leveled and that the results will be durable and visually appealing.

FAQ

Concrete Raising Questions

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that lifts and stabilizes sunken or uneven concrete surfaces, restoring their original position and appearance.

What types of projects can benefit from concrete raising? Dri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ors are common projects that can be improved with concrete raising.

How does concrete raising work? The process involves injecting a specialized material beneath the surface to lift and level the concrete slab.

Is concrete raising a suitable solution for all cracks and damages? Concrete raising is effective for uneven slabs and minor cracks but may not be suitable for severely damaged or cracked concrete.
